How much do level 3 eng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for level 3 engineer in the United States is $101,752.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$84,000.00 and $116,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a level 3 engineer?

A Level 3 Engineer is a mid- to senior-level technical professional responsible for diagnosing and resolving complex issues, often providing advanced support and mentoring to lower-level engineers. They typically have several years of experience, relevant certifications, and proficiency with tools and systems related to their field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Level 3 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Level 3 Engineer, you need advanced technical expertise in your engineering discipline, strong problem-solving abilities, and several years of relevant experience, often supported by a bachelor's or master's degree. Proficiency with industry-specific tools such as CAD software, network management platforms, or specialized engineering systems, along with relevant certifications like CCNP or PE, is typically required. Excellent communication, leadership, and teamwork skills help you manage complex projects and mentor junior staff. These skills ensure effective troubleshooting, project delivery, and the ability to handle high-level technical challenges within an organization.

What are Level 3 Engineers?

Level 3 Engineers, often referred to as Tier 3 or L3 engineers, are highly skilled technical professionals responsible for handling the most complex and advanced support issues within an organization. They provide expert troubleshooting, perform root cause analysis, and often design or implement solutions for escalated problems that lower-tier engineers cannot resolve. L3 engineers may also contribute to system architecture, mentor junior staff, and collaborate on strategic projects to improve IT infrastructure and services.

How does a Level 3 Engineer typically interact with junior engineers and other technical teams?

Level 3 Engineers often serve as technical mentors and subject matter experts within their organizations. They collaborate closely with junior engineers, providing guidance on complex troubleshooting, code reviews, and best practices. Additionally, they act as escalation points for difficult issues and frequently work cross-functionally with other departments, such as product management or operations, to ensure solutions are implemented effectively. This collaborative environment allows Level 3 Engineers to both share their expertise and stay updated on evolving technologies.

In this role, the Systems Engineer - Level 3 will work in tandem with a scrum team of other software and systems engineers responsible for defining the product vision, managing the product backlog, and ensuring that all features align with business objectives. You will work closely with cross-functional teams to prioritize tasks and facilitate the timely delivery of high-quality mission focused software systems solutions. Additionally, you will incorporate user feedback to continuously refine the product roadmap and drive innovation in response to evolving customer needs. Development is done within the Agile paradigm using the Atlassian tool suite, so you will need to be able to work within an Agile environment.

You will have experience in systems engineering with space domain knowledge, and you will define the requirements, interfaces, processes, use cases, protocols, schemas, sequence of interactions driving the software design for Ground Segment Functions for a system. You will integrate and test software segments, automate tests, verify requirements, and deliver products to operations. You will be supporting a program through full life-cycle milestones in Agile sprints to achieve the mission, you will have strong verbal and written communication skills, and you are expected to operate independently with little oversight in a dynamic environment. You will have experience with MBSE (Model Based Systems Engineering), CAMEO, SysML diagramming, requirements & verification, domain and mission knowledge, and work with or as software system engineering. You are highly self-motivated, reporting information to leads and the customer. You are expected to handle diverse assignments with efficiency, find unique solutions, and work in a very collaborative and fast-paced environment that continues to grow.
